About the role

As a Building Pathology Surveyor, you will play a key role in protecting and enhancing the safety, performance and longterm value of Wheatley’s diverse housing stock. You will undertake detailed technical assessments, diagnose complex building defects and develop evidenceled repair and investment solutions that improve outcomes for our customers.

Working across a wide range of residential building archetypes, you will provide professional technical advice to colleagues, support responses to customer complaints and inform preventative maintenance and investment programmes. You will collaborate closely with teams across assets, repairs, housing, sustainability and compliance, as well as external specialists where required. You will contribute to strategic asset planning and innovative approaches to managing building pathology challenges, including damp, mould, condensation and future net zero priorities.
